At 15:20 on Wednesday July 29th, 2009 United fire was dispatched for the
reported structure fire on RT 29 on Lake Montrose. United 11 (P. Sprout)
was the first officer to arrive with a smoke condition in the basement
and heat in the floor on division 1. United Engine 2, Engine 6, Rescue 1
and the utility would respond. crews made entry into a basement crawl
space to find a small electrical fire that had damaged a propane gas
line. Exterior crews controlled the electrical and gas to the residence.
crews were quickly able to control the fire. Units remained on scene
overhauling and metering the house for any hidden pockets of gas. Crews
operated on the scene for an hour with command being terminated at
16:30. There were no injuries reported and there was only minor damage
reported to the residence. The home owner was advised to contact
qualified servicemen to make repairs.
